Posts feature insight and analysis about domain name disputes, online brand protection issues and other Internet legal issues.

Author: Doug Isenberg is an attorney who serves as GigaLaw's editor and publisher. A former news reporter and magazine editor, he is the founder of The GigaLaw Firm in Atlanta, where he practices IP and Internet law. He also serves as a domain name panelist for the World Intellectual Property Organization.
